Jesse Hirsch subjects himself to the "ritualized religious experience" that is Tekka (537 Balboa Street) sushi in the Inner Richmond. The sashimi platter is "gorgeous and generous," but he can't tell if the theatrics of its "strict," "notorious" setting alter the experience. Still you should go, and "learn about the off-menu items" too. [Examiner]
